[ Workarounds (reported to work by some people) ] * Configure the monitor (in its own menus) to not auto-switch inputs. * Change from HDMI to DisplayPort cables. * Disable HDMI audio output. [ Test Plan ] 0. Make sure you're using an LCD (not OLED) so you can see if the backlight is on. 1. In Settings -> Power -> Screen Blank, set the inactivity period to 1 minute. 2. Verify after 1 minute that the screen is blank and the backlight is also visibly off.
